ABSTRACT

<p><b>OBJECTIVE</b>To investigate the feasibility of establishing an integrated regional network for ST-segment elevation myocardial infarction (STEMI) care in China and evaluate the implementation effect of this network.</p><p><b>METHODS</b>Based on real-time electrocardiogram transmission technology, we established an integrated regional network for STEMI care (IRN-STEMI) with Xiamen Heart Center as the core center, 120 Emergency Systems, PCI-capable hospitals and other community health units as core elements of this network. Reperfusion treatment data of Xiamen Heart Center including the number of patients receiving primary percutaneous coronary intervention (PCI), the mean first medical contact to balloon (FMC-to-B) time, the mean door to balloon (D-to-B) time, the mean length of hospital stay, the mean medical cost and in-hospital mortality were compared before (n = 165) and at 1 year after the built-up of IRN-STEMI (n = 343).</p><p><b>RESULTS</b>Compared to pre-IRN-STEMI era, primary PCI ratio (84.5% (290/343) vs. 75.5% (185/245)) were significantly increased post establishment of IRN-STEMI within the network (P = 0.06). STEMI patients admitted in Xiamen Heart Center was significantly increased from 165 to 256, the annual mean FMC-to-B time ((110.3 ± 34.0)min vs. (137.9 ± 58.5) min, P < 0.01) and D-to-B ( (76.5 ± 33.0) min vs. (107.3 ± 38.0) min, P < 0.01) , as well as the mean medical cost were significantly decreased ( (51 398 ± 22 100) RMB vs. (56 970 ± 24 593) RMB, P < 0.05), while the mean length of hospital stay ((9.0 ± 4.3)d vs. (9.7 ± 4.8)d, P > 0.05) and in-hospital mortality (3.1% (8/256) vs. 3.0% (5/165) , P > 0.05) remained unchanged before and after the setting of IRN-STEMI in Xiamen Heart Center.</p><p><b>CONCLUSION</b>Establishment of an integrated regional network system for STEMI patients in China is feasible. With collaboration of qualified heart center, EMS and PCI-capable and non-PCI capable local hospitals, establishment of IRN-STEMI effectively increased the ratio of primary PCI for STEMI patients, it also significantly shortened the FMC-to-B and D-to-B time, decreased mean medical cost, thus, the regional IRN-STEMI network might be an effective working system for improving the medical care for STEMI patients.</p>

ABSTRACT

BACKGROUND:Lysophosphatidic acid (LPA) had 3 kinds of receptors in vitro. Some researches had showed that LPA1, LPA2 and LPA3 receptors distributed widely in mouse cerebral cortex, nephritic external medulla layer and internal medulla layer, spermary, thymus, heart, lung, stomach, spleen, whereas less in liver, small intestine and skeletal muscles. Whether there are various LPA receptors in mouse VSMC membrane deserves further study.OBJECTIVE: To observe the mRNA expression of LPA receptors in vascular smooth muscle cells (VSMC).DESIGN: Observational comparative experiment.SETTING: Tongji Medical College, Huazhong University of Science and Technology.MATERIALS: A total of 24 C57BL/6 mice aged 7-8 weeks, of either sex, with the body mass of approximately (25±3) g,were purchased from the Animal Department of Tongji Medical College, Huazhong University of Science and Technology. Trizol was purchased from America Invitrogen; dNTP Mix, Rnasin were obtained from TaKaRa; M-MLV reverse transcriptase and buffer system were from Promega; Taq DNA-polymerase and buffer system were from Biostar.Oligo(dT)18 primer were from Sangon, Shanghai. Primer sequences were designed referring to literature and nucleotide sequence database and synthesized by Sangon, Shanghai.METHODS: The experiment was conducted at the Comprehensive Laboratory, Tongji Medical College, Huazhong University of Science and Technology between August 2005 and January 2006. Mice were anaesthetized by abdominal cavity with 20 g/L ketamine (5 mL/kg). Thoracic aorta was obtained sterilely, and VSMC was cultured with adherence method. The 4th-6th passage cells were used in the trial. Cell purity was over 95%. Reverse transcriptase-polymerase chain reaction (RT-PCR) was applied to determine the mRNA expression of LPA receptors gene in mouse VSMC.MAIN OUTCOME MEASURES: Detection of mRNA expression of LPA receptors in mouse VSMC and comparison of receptor types.RESULTS: There were no significant differences between the expressions of LPA1 receptors and LPA2 receptors (P > 0.05). Compared with LPA1 receptors and LPA2 receptors (0.79±0.05,0.82±0.06), the LPA3 receptor expression was lower (0.53±0.05, q =23.78,26.53, P< 0.01 ).CONCLUSION: There are 3 kinds of LPA receptors in VSMC, and their molecular masses are 600 bp, 463 bp and 899 bp,respectively. There are no differences for the expressions between LPA1 receptors and LPA2 receptors, while the LPA3 receptor expression is less.
